Windcat Workboats, part of Compagnie Maritime Belge (CMB), is Europe’s leading provider of specialist crew transfer vessels to the offshore wind power industry, oil and gas industry and other offshore projects..
Willem van der Wel joined Windcat over 10 years ago and has been involved in all aspects of the Windcat business from newbuilds to operational management as well as the chartering side of the business as Windcat’s Business Development Manager.
Willem has since taken the helm from the founders of Windcat Workboats, becoming Managing Director in 2019, and is now highly involved in the design, build and certification process of the vessels as well as the development of potential hydrogen infrastructures following the acquisition of Windcat Workboats in 2020 by Compagnie Maritime Belge, partner in developing the Hydrogen Dual Fuel CTV.
